What can i take to fend off start of a cold while breastfeeding?

Boost your immune system by bumping up the nutritional content of your diet. In particular foods that give you plenty of iron, B vitamins and vitamin C. Kiwifruit is especially good, for example, as it's rich in Vitamin C and helps you absorb more iron from your food. Garlic, chilli-peppers and onions might not make you the most popular member of the baby-group (!) but they have fantastic antiseptic properties.

Keep your fluid intake up.... many of the problems with colds are due to dehydration. Rest is a must... don't try to overdo things. And, if sinuses get blocked, the old trick of putting some Olbas Oil in a bowl of very hot water, making a steam 'tent' with a towel and inhaling is much more effective than decongestants.
